Promise of Jesus

Now the Lord said to Abram,

“Go forth from your country,

And from your relatives

And from your father’s house,

To the land which I will show you;

And I will make you a great nation,

And I will bless you,

And make your name great;

And so you shall be a blessing;

And I will bless those who bless you,

And the one who curses you I will curse.

And in you all the families of the earth will be blessed.” Genesis 12:1-3

 

Father, we come before You today and we thank You. We thank You that You, our Father, honors Your Word. We are amazed at Your promises to Abraham. We are humbled by the righteousness You freely give to those who believe. As we study and meditate on Your Word, let faith arise in our hearts. We pray for the faith that Abraham had, the faith that believes You honor Your promises. Give us the faith to believe that our families are Yours. Faith to believe Your Word, planted deep in their hearts, still works life in them. We are blessed through Jesus Who came to us through Your promises to Abraham.

 

We thank You for our children and families. We thank You for Your faithfulness to love them even when we despair. Thank You for being a loving God who rescues the lost and hurting. Thank You for never leaving or forsaking them. Thank You that You alone know everything, and we can believe on You.

 

We trust that You are working in our children and families.  You gave them to us, just as You gave Isaac to Abraham.

 

 So, now we trust and we believe in a God who is bigger than addictions, bigger than sins, bigger than hurts and rebellion. We submit in the timing of Your plan. Our deliverer, Jehovah Jireh, our provider. You provide our peace and a place of peace. We give You praise and glory, God of all.
